Transaction e3c72e945623f00364181b56de680a82fc66de18d993356aea3b21018f141a46
1 Input
1 Output
-
e3c72e945623f00364181b56de680a82fc66de18d993356aea3b21018f141a46:0
- value
- 10011746
- script pubkey
- OP_0 OP_PUSHBYTES_20 00b9524926916dc77fda983ce55949aeadb54d2b
- address
- bc1qqzu4yjfxj9kuwl76nq7w2k2f46km2nftm0ewwa